The Premise of Education Is to Love Others


In terms of time, students spend much more time in the dormitory and community than in class. The phenomena of overcrowded accommodation, incomplete living facilities and disordered articles in the room have always been major problems in college student affairs. After years of exploration, we propose to transform the traditional student dormitory space into a beautiful community education environment and undertake the mission of education. Xi'an Eurasia University has set up eight student-themed communities, promoting counselors and teachers to enter the community, so that students of different majors can live in the same dormitory and experience a diversified social atmosphere.


The premise of education is to love others! Only with complete facilities to meet the life needs of students and a beautiful environment to facilitate students can we establish mutual trust and respect between school and classmates. All departments of Xi'an Eurasia University have cooperated to study students' living needs and implement "Life Quality Improvement Actions" in student communities, including "Air Conditioning Plan", "Living Room Plan", "Bathing Plan", "Laundry Plan", "Toilet Revolution" and "Storage Plan". They have invested a lot to continuously transform all aspects of the community.


Starting this year, we have put forward the community shared values, covering cleanliness, health, friendliness and self-discipline. This expresses the common commitment of community counselors, housekeepers, cleaners and students to the development of student communities. I do not advocate the simple use of strict discipline to regulate people's behavior. Instead, through value guidance and the establishment of "Student Convention", students can gradually have neat hygiene habits, healthy lifestyles and friendly attitudes and behaviors, so as to enjoy the happiness of growth brought by self-discipline in community life.


There are also many warm and thoughtful service designs in the student communities of Xi'an Eurasia University, such as customized cleaning services, laundry services, luggage trolleys, microwave ovens, storage boxes, cartoons in corridors and wind bells in gardens. The Essence of Education Is to Change Ideas


Mathematician Riemann once said: What is more important than solving a single problem is to redefine the set of problems. Many times, when we are stuck on a certain problem and cannot get the answer, the best way is to newly classify and integrate the relevant elements of the problem. We can often re-understand the problem and find a solution.


The success of the "Life Quality Improvement Actions" is due to our reordering of relevant elements. We found that the three main factors to improve students' accommodation experience are: reducing the number of occupants in each room, improving basic services and contents and establishing shared values to guide students' behaviors. Once the order is reversed, this aggregation effect will no longer exist.


Limited by financial resources, the "Life Quality Improvement Actions" can only be implemented gradually, and not all students enjoy the same excellent service facilities. You can also see that the International Student Apartment designed by the Australia-based design company Denton Corker Marshall (DCM) is about to be topped out, and the supporting new gymnasium and swimming pool will also start construction soon. Next year, Xi'an Eurasia University will have one of the highest-quality student apartments among China's universities.

Convey Ideas and Contribute Value


Student development theory points out that human growth requires the transformation from the natural person to social person to organizer, and finally to professional. The above-mentioned community education is to make up for the shortcomings of our previous education and train students to become better social people and organizers through a beautiful community environment.


You're going to be an organizer soon. Within an organization, there is a focus on both achieving the organizational mission and meeting individual development needs. There is a delicate balance between the two. The best organizational state is to align the organization's mission with individual development goals.


Peter Drucker told the story of three masons in The Practice of Management. When someone asked the three masons what they were doing, the first mason said, "I am supporting my family." The second mason replied, "I am doing the best masonry work in the country." The third mason looked up at the sky with bright eyes and said, “I am building a cathedral."


In Drucker's view, the first mason's harvest was only a daily wage. The second mason is more concerned with his craft than understanding the purpose and ultimate meaning of his craft. The third mason has a vision, positioning his work from a holistic perspective to find meaning and create value. Confucius said, "A gentleman is not a tool." Once a man becomes a tool, his horizon narrows.
